Guinea pig(s) housing requirements
A pair of guinea pigs need a minimum of 4ft x 2ft (8sq foot). My ideal housing would be an indoor cage for the winter months and a summer hutch with a run.
I am happy to house to outside hutches with adequate cover. Hutches in a shed with window is another good idea of accommodation.
Rabbit housing requirements
I would love to see all the rabbits rehomed to accommodation of a shed with a large run attached. This I feel is a lovely set up, the buns love them and they have somewhere to go when it rains or is too cold.
Failing that then the minimum for 2 buns is a 6ft x 2ft x 2ft hutch with a run attached or with a run for the day time.
I am not keen on the use of woodshavings and prefer megazorb or hemp based material like aubiose. I would love to see the buns with cardboard boxes to play in, possible wicker baskets, wooden houses or small hutches with the fronts taken off for them to sit in.

I am not a fan of these 'treats' the pet shops sell for bunnies, best treat for a rabbit is a box or cardboard tube filled with hay and some veggies or readi grass.
